I would be scared that water would enter the foam area and the whole thing decompose. Water running off is a bit different than standing in the stuff.
We used to use bondo on the curved back edge of boat transoms to make them square. A curved edge would make you loose .5-1 mile an hour. Then we put ployeurethane paint over the bottom after it was preped. It would not work for boats left in water.
